Output d22a287f1cddf08146dbac38b4998766f6ba97d019c2f980337d025b68cb38a7:2

value
34977495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ca658d185c12c577311061df2c19aaa55e15b40 OP_EQUAL
address
MDRr3voo4CgPATVxjCCJseuDNnfFxgTL4T
transaction
d22a287f1cddf08146dbac38b4998766f6ba97d019c2f980337d025b68cb38a7
spent
true